First, we should describe the terms in the question to make it clearer. Policy is defined as a plan or course of action, as of a government, political party, or business, planned to influence and determine decisions, actions, and other matters. Power in politics is the ability or official capacity to exercise control; authority. With this explained, we can infer that the connection is that the state government has the "power" to set "policy" about various matters.
